Baykal (port) (Russian: Байка́л (порт)) is a rural locality (a settlement) in Slyudyansky District of Irkutsk Oblast, Russia, located near Lake Baikal on the left bank of the Angara River, 60 kilometers (37 mi) south of Irkutsk, the administrative center of the oblast. Population: 425 (2010 Russian census);[1] 504 (2002 Census);[2] 613 (1989 Soviet census).[3]
